In a piece of heartbreaking news, veteran Nepali actor, Sunil Thapa passed away at the age of 68. The actor was best known to play villainous characters and also essayed Priyanka Chopra's coach in the biopic drama titled, Mary Kom. The news of Sunil's demise was confirmed by the Cine & TV Artistes’ Association (CINTAA) on February 7, 2026. Now, a while back, Priyanka Chopra, who played the lead role of Mary Kom in the biopic, took to her social media handle to offer the most heart-wrenching tribute to her 'coach sir', Sunil Thapa.

Priyanka Chopra offers an emotional tribute to her 'coach sir', Sunil Thapa, and credits him for holding her when she lost her father

Priyanka Chopra was very close to her father, the late Dr Ashok Chopra, whom she lost in 2013 after his long fight with cancer. Sunil, was best known for playing 'M.Narijit Singh', Priyanka's coach in the 2014 movie, Mary Kom. A while back, Priyanka took to her Instagram handle to share a video from the film where Sunil was seen making her do hardcore training for boxing. Priyanka, in her emotional tribute, remembered how her 'coach sir', Sunil Thapa stood by her when she lost her father and wrote:

"You will always be my Coach Sir. You kept me together when I had just lost my dad. You loved me and helped me through many tough days without even realising it. Your warm hugs and your laugh will always be part of my memories. Gone too young but never forgotten. Thank you for your kindness at a time that I was broken. Rest in peace Sunil Thapa. My condolences and prayers are with the family and loved ones."

Did Sunil Thapa die of cardiac arrest?

Sunil Thapa is also best known for playing the role of Nagaland leader, 'David Khuzou', in The Family Man Season 3, which stars Manoj Bajpayee. It was in November 2025 that the hit web series of Raj&DK premiered. Now, according to reports on social media, Sunil was undergoing medical treatment in Nepal's capital when his health suddenly deteriorated. He was reportedly taken to the hospital when he was in a state of unconsciousness, and then an ECG was done. He was declared dead due to a suspected cardiac arrest.
